Zebulon is a city in Pike County, Georgia, United States. The population was 1,225 in 2020. The city is the county seat of Pike County. The city and county were named after explorer Zebulon Pike. Zebulon is situated 3 miles west of Nazareth Church.

Meansville is a city in Pike County, Georgia, United States. The population was 266 at the 2020 census. Meansville is situated 3½ miles south of Nazareth Church.

Milner is a city in Lamar County, Georgia, United States. The population was 610 at the 2010 census, up from 522 at the 2000 census. Milner is part of Metro Atlanta. Milner is situated 5 miles east of Nazareth Church.
